Home | History | Annotate | Download | only in include
History log of /src/sys/arch/mips/atheros/include/arbusvar.h
RevisionDateAuthorComments
 1.5  09-Jun-2015  matt #include <sys/cpu.h> or <mips/cpuregs.h> as needed
 1.4  10-Jul-2011  matt branches: 1.4.12; 1.4.30;
Add athers_get_uart_freq() (since AR7240 uses the ref_clk, not the bus_clk).
Add little endian bus_space_tag for arbus.
Add EHCI attachment for arbus.
 1.3  01-Jul-2011  dyoung #include <sys/bus.h> instead of <machine/bus.h>.
 1.2  04-Sep-2006  gdamore branches: 1.2.4;
This is a boat-load of changes designed to finish parameterizing the
stuff necessary to separate out AR5312 from AR5315. This includes:

1) rework of arbus IRQs, so that IRQs are now seperately specified
as either MISC or CPU irqs
2) move board/chip-specific addresses into chip-dependent file
3) unencumber argpio from ar5312 specifics, using properties to pass
details such as reset-pin and sysled-pin.
4) an option to select which WiSoC is to be configured is provided.

AR5315 support should be forthcoming shortly now.
 1.1  21-Mar-2006  gdamore branches: 1.1.2; 1.1.4; 1.1.6; 1.1.8; 1.1.14;
Initial import of Atheros AR531X SoC support. Currently the onboard ethernet
and serial ports are supported, and the system appears stable with an NFS
mounted root. An earlier version of the code was reviewed by simon@, but it
has since had numerous improvements and cleanups.


At the moment, only AR5312 is known to work, but I suspect AR2313 will work
as well. Later 2315/2316 parts are substantially different, and are not yet
supported. Wifi and Marvell switch support found on some designs are not yet
supported.

Platforms known to include AR5312 include Senao Aries 2 (AP5054) and Netgear
WGU624.
 1.1.14.3  30-Dec-2006  yamt sync with head.
 1.1.14.2  21-Jun-2006  yamt sync with head.
 1.1.14.1  21-Mar-2006  yamt file arbusvar.h was added on branch yamt-lazymbuf on 2006-06-21 14:53:38 +0000
 1.1.8.2  22-Apr-2006  simonb Sync with head.
 1.1.8.1  21-Mar-2006  simonb file arbusvar.h was added on branch simonb-timecounters on 2006-04-22 11:37:42 +0000
 1.1.6.2  19-Apr-2006  elad sync with head - hopefully this will work
 1.1.6.1  21-Mar-2006  elad file arbusvar.h was added on branch elad-kernelauth on 2006-04-19 02:33:18 +0000
 1.1.4.3  14-Sep-2006  yamt sync with head.
 1.1.4.2  11-Apr-2006  yamt sync files somehow mis-tagged by yamt-pdpolicy-base2.
 1.1.4.1  21-Mar-2006  yamt file arbusvar.h was added on branch yamt-pdpolicy on 2006-04-11 12:20:51 +0000
 1.1.2.2  28-Mar-2006  tron Merge 2006-03-28 NetBSD-current into the "peter-altq" branch.
 1.1.2.1  21-Mar-2006  tron file arbusvar.h was added on branch peter-altq on 2006-03-28 09:47:17 +0000
 1.2.4.2  09-Sep-2006  rpaulo sync with head
 1.2.4.1  04-Sep-2006  rpaulo file arbusvar.h was added on branch rpaulo-netinet-merge-pcb on 2006-09-09 02:41:25 +0000
 1.4.30.1  22-Sep-2015  skrll Sync with HEAD
 1.4.12.1  03-Dec-2017  jdolecek update from HEAD

RSS XML Feed